gpt4 book ai didi

php - Laravel 表单回显变量

转载 作者:可可西里 更新时间:2023-11-01 01:15:22 25 4
gpt4 key购买 nike

我仍在学习如何使用 Laravel。现在我已经学会了如何在 Laravel 中制作表单。但是我在回应一个变量时遇到了一些麻烦。我想做的是:如果这个变量存在,我想回显一个变量作为输入字段的值,否则它什么都不回显。所以我的表单行看起来像这样

  {{Form::text(
'league_name',
'@if(isset($varialble) {{$variable}} @else {{$nothing}} @endif)'
)}}

如何在表单中回显变量?

顺便说一句,我正在使用 Blade 。

最佳答案

正确的做法是:

{!! Form::text('league_name', isset($varialble) ? $variable : '') !!}

如果您使用的是 PHP7,您可以这样做:

{!! Form::text('league_name', $varialble) ?? '') !!}

更新

要添加占位符,将其作为第三个参数传递到数组中。另外,你通常想通过一个类:

{!! Form::text('league_name', isset($varialble) ? $variable : '', ['placeholder' => 'My placeholder', 'class' => 'form-control']) !!}

关于php - Laravel 表单回显变量,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/40528264/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com